Hi guys. I have no idea whats happening to my frontpage (http://www.snowboard-guide.dk) my icons and text will not be on the same line – they almost showing in a stairs-like line.

I really dont get why. I just want the to be on the same line, same height.

    Hi Jonas

    Give this a try.

    1. Start over and try using our Page Builder plugin for your home page. If it’s installed you’ll see a tab next to Visual / Text. Delete your regular content first.
    2. Try using the Visual Editor widget to add your content, to get access to that widget first install:

    http://wordpress.org/plugins/black-studio-tinymce-widget/

    3. Try adding one Visual Editor widget per item.

    Hopefully that helps.

  2. Greg Priday Staff 11 years, 5 months ago

    I had a quick look at the code on your front page and it seems like there are some break tags being added. It’s possible that WordPress is automatically adding these, but you might be able to remove them in the text tab of the editor.

    Andrew’s solution is the best though. Page Builder loves these types of layouts.
